Answer:

15 + 3b

6f + 10

Step-by-step explanation:

Distributive property: a*(b +c) = (a*b) + a*c)

  Multiply 3 with 5 and multiply 3 with b and then add the results of the multiplication.

3*(5 + b) = (3*5) + (3*b)

              = 15 + 3b

2*(3f + 5) = (2*3f) + (2*5)

               = 6f + 10
